The short answer to whether祛斑機 can彻底 remove spots is no—but it can effectively fade many common spots, provided you use it right and target the correct type of spot. Think of it not as a "magic eraser" for spots, but as a "smart helper" that breaks down excess melanin—if you know how to let it do its job well.
First, spot type determines if it works. Not all spots are created equal: superficial spots like sun spots (from long-term UV exposure) or post-acne brown marks live in the top skin layer (epidermis). For these, machines like IPL or laser can easily reach the melanin, shattering it into tiny particles that your body flushes out. You might see fading after 3-5 sessions. But deep spots like melasma (hormonal spots linked to pregnancy or birth control) or birthmarks sit in the dermis (deeper layer). Using a祛斑機 here won’t penetrate enough—worse, it could irritate skin and trigger more melanin production, making spots darker. So before buying, confirm your spot type (ask a dermatologist if unsure).
Second, proper usage beats expensive machines. Even a high-end祛斑機 fails if you skip pre/post care. Take at-home IPL: Pre-care means avoiding sun exposure 2 weeks prior (tanned skin burns easily) and stopping exfoliants. During use, setting intensity too low does nothing; too high causes blisters. Post-care is non-negotiable: After treatment, skin is sensitive—skip SPF 50+ sunscreen, and spots will return faster. Third, at-home vs salon: Manage expectations. Salon machines have stronger energy and professional operation (fast results but pricier—1000-2000 yuan/session). At-home machines are safer for beginners but lower in energy; you need 3-6 months of consistent use (1-2x/week) to see fading, with less dramatic effects. Choose salon for speed, at-home for budget and patience.
To sum up,祛斑機 is useful but not a miracle. It works best for superficial spots, demands proper care, and your choice (at-home/salon) depends on budget and patience.
